IT実験のブログ

IT関連のツールの使い方など

2020-01-01から1年間の記事一覧

世界はグレートリセットの真っ只中です。

グレートリセットとは、経済秩序、暮らし方、働き方など全てがリセットすることを言います。 リーマンショックの頃から少しずつ始まっており、2040年頃まで続くらしいです。 来年の世界経済フォーラムの年次総会(ダボス会議)のテーマも「グレートリセット…

最近VYONDというツールを使って動画作成にハマっています。

VYOND凄いです。 使いやすくて、こんな感じのアニメーションがさくっと作れます。 www.youtube.com パワーポイントのスキルがあれば、アニメーションを作れると言われています。 テンプレートのアニメーションを選択して、キャラクターをカスタマイズして、…

MacOS(10.15) でピクセラさんのXit Stick(XIT-STK100)を使う方法が分かったと思いきや、やっぱりダメかもしれないと思っていたら、たまに映ったりする話

Macでテレビが見たかったので、 ピクセラさんのXit Stick(XIT-STK100)をAmazonで購入しましたが、すぐに動かなくなってしまいました。 www.amazon.co.jp ピクセラさんのホームページで仕様を確認すると、macOS 10.15 には対応していないようなので仕方がな…

新型コロナについて調べて分かったこと

PCR検査は精度が良くない PCR検査で新型コロナに感染しているかどうか検査することができますが、精度があまり良くないです。 下のサイトによると、ある程度のウイルス量が無ければ、精度は60%〜70%となってしまいます。 精度70%としても、10人に…

お祈りします3

今日は、少し体調が悪いです。 ストレスが溜まっているのか、疲れが溜まっているのか。 コロナのおかげで、ずっと家に籠っているからか。 普段仕事のある時も、体調が悪い日は早めに切り上げたり休んだりすることがたまにあります。 そんな人は結構いると思…

お祈りします2

さて、今回も前回に続き お祈り回にしようと思います。 新型コロナのおかげで休業やリストラの憂き目にあってしまっている方も多いと思います。 自分も今はテレワークで働いていますが、数ヶ月後には休業やリストラにあっているかもしれません。 また、何と…

お祈りします

新型コロナのおかげで大変な毎日になりましたね。 以前、こんな記事を読んだことがあります。 祈りの効果について検証した実験についての記事です。 ある病院で、患者をAグループとBグループに分けました。 Aグループは、他人に祈りを捧げてもらいます。 Bグ…

VirtualBoxにAndroid8.1をインストールする方法

VirtualBoxにAndroid8.1をインストールできましたので、その方法についてシェアしたいと思います。ただし、アプリはあまり動きません。 ホストPCは、MacBook Pro 16インチ 2019年版を使いました。 Android-x86のrpm版を使いますので、Ubuntuの仮想マシンを作…

VirtualBoxにAndroid9.0をインストールする方法

VirtualBoxにAndroid9.0をインストールできましたので、その方法についてシェアしたいと思います。ただし、アプリはあまり動きません。 ホストPCは、MacBook Pro 16インチ 2019年版を使いました。 Android-x86のrpm版を使いますので、Ubuntuの仮想マシンを作…

Macでハースストーンをダウンロードできなかったので、VirtualBoxにAndroid9.0をインストールしました。(失敗)

久しぶりにMacでハースストーン でもして遊ぶかと思い、公式サイトにアクセスしてダウンロードしようとしましたが、何回やっても途中でネットワークが切断されてダウンロード完了しませんでした。 光回線ではなく、Wifiルーター使ってるので回線が遅いせいか…

Ubuntu18.04でTensorflowを使って、3種類のナッツの画像を識別する

前回で画像認識ができるようになりましたので、今回は、3種類のナッツの画像を識別してみたいと思います。 ヘーゼルナッツ、アーモンド、くるみの3種類のナッツの画像をそれぞれ54枚 iPhoneで撮影して用意しました。 54枚中の50枚を訓練用の画像にし…

Tensorflowのimage_retrainingという画像認識を使ってみる

今回は、Ubuntu18.04上で、Tensorflowのimage_retrainingという画像認識を使ってみます。 GitHub - tensorflow/hub at r0.7 まず、こちらのサイトにブラウザでアクセスして、「Clone or download」ボタンから必要なツールをダウンロードして、~/AI に置きま…

Tensorflowのlabel_imageツールを使ってみる

https://github.com/tensorflow/tensorflow/tree/master/tensorflow/examples/label_image 今回は、こちらのサイトを参考にして、Tensorflowのlabel_imageツールを使ってみます。 cd ~/AI/tensorflow inception v3 のFrozenGraphDefをダウンロードして、所定…

MacにVirtualBox入れてUbuntu18.04を動かしている場合のキー設定

MacにVirtualBox入れてUbuntu18.04を動かしていると、Mac上ではコピーはcommand+Cだけど、Ubuntuでは、control+Cとなってしまって、ややこしいのでMacと同じ操作でできるように合わせたいと思います。 Ubuntuソフトウェアを起動して、検索ボックスに tweak …

freeze_graphツール、summarize_graphツール、label_imageツールを使ってみる

https://github.com/tensorflow/models/tree/r1.13.0/research/slim こちらのサイトを参考にしながら、前回ビルドしたツールを使ってみます。 slimのディレクトリに移動します。 cd ~/AI/models/research/slim download_and_convert_flowers.py を少し修正し…

Tensorflow のバージョンを1.13.1にして、freeze_graphツール、summarize_graphツール、label_imageツールをビルドする

https://www.tensorflow.org/install/source?hl=ja こちらのサイトによると、Tensorflow 1.13.1までしかテスト済みのビルドが無いらしいので、 今回は、Tensorflow 1.15.2から1.13.1に変更します。そして、各種ツールのビルドを行います。 各種ツールをビル…

Tensorflowのinceptionという画像認識のexampleを試す(実際に花の画像を認識させる)(失敗2)

今回は、先日(2020/2/15)生成したflowersを認識するDNNモデルを使って、実際に花の画像を認識させてみたいと思います。 先日生成したものは、チェックポイントなので、FrozenGraphDefという形式(pbファイル)に変換する必要があります。 まず、GraphDefをエ…

Ubuntu18.04にgoogle chromeをインストールする(Tensorboardの全機能を正常に動作させたい)

今回は、Ubuntu18.04にgoogle chromeをインストールしてみます。 目的は、Tensorboardの全ての機能を正常に動作させるためです。 Firefoxでも問題なさそうですが、念のためインストールしておきます。 こちらのサイトからchromeをダウンロードします。 Googl…

Tensorflowのinceptionという画像認識のexampleを試す(実際に花の画像を認識させる)(失敗)

今回は、先日(2020/2/15)生成したflowersを認識するDNNモデルを使って、実際に花の画像を認識させてみたいと思います。 先日生成したものは、チェックポイントなので、FrozenGraphDefという形式(pbファイル)に変換する必要があります。 まず、inception v3…

Tensorboardを使ってみる

今回は、Tensorboardというツールを使ってみます。 準備として、 setuptoolsをアップグレードします。 pip3 install -U setuptools エラーが出ていますが、setuptoolsのアップグレード自体は成功しています。 インストールされているツールのリストを出して…

Ubuntu18.04のスワップ領域を増やす

今回は、Ubuntu18.04のスワップ領域を増やしたいと思います。 元から1.9GBありますが、4GB追加します。 端末から下のコマンドを実行して、/swapfile2 という名前の4GBのファイルを作成します。 sudo fallocate -l 4G /swapfile2 そのファイルの権限を変更し…

Tensorflowのimagenetという画像認識のtutorialを試す

今回は、Tensorflowのimagenetという画像認識のtutorialを試してみます。 画像に何が写っているかを識別するAIです。 下のコマンドでtutorialのディレクトリに移動します。 cd ~/AI/models/tutorials/image/imagenet 下のコマンドで画像認識のプログラムを実…

Tensorflowのinceptionという画像認識のexampleを試す(step数を減らして再度訓練処理を実行する)

前回までで訓練処理のstep数が大きすぎて、訓練が完全に終了しなかったので、今回はstep数を小さくして再トライしようと思います。 ソースファイルを眺めていたら、max_steps なるFLAGがあるようなので、これを500にして試してみます。ちなみにデフォルトは1…

Tensorflowのinceptionという画像認識のexampleを試す(評価処理から)(失敗)

前回でinceptionの訓練処理までを行いました。 というか、訓練開始から5時間たちましたが、まだ完了していません。 しかし、step数は2310まで行きましたので、途中ですが いつ終わるか分かりませんので、現状のモデルで評価処理を行いたいと思います。公式…

Tensorflowのinceptionという画像認識のexampleを試す(訓練処理まで)

今回は、inceptionという画像認識のexampleを試してみます。 これは一枚の写真をインプットにして、何が写っているかを識別するものです。 データをダウンロードしてデータセット作成、モデルの訓練、認識処理実行という流れで進めていきます。 モデルの訓練…

bazelというビルドツールをUbuntu18.04にインストールする

今回は、bazelというビルドツールをインストールします。 bazelはgoogleが開発している次世代のビルドツールで、Javaで書かれているそうです。 Firefoxでこのサイトにアクセスします。 https://github.com/bazelbuild/bazel/releases 下の方にスクロールして…

Tensorflowのチュートリアルを実行してみます(Irisの識別)

今回は、前回ダウンロードしたmodelsディレクトリの中にあるチュートリアルを実行してみます。 Irisという花のデータをインプットして、それがどの種類のIrisなのかを識別するAIのチュートリアルです。 端末を起動して、下のコマンドを実行してチュートリア…

Tensorflow/modelsをダウンロードする

今回は、Tensorflowで使える使用例などが沢山入っているgithubのリポジトリをダウンロードします。 https://github.com/tensorflow/models ここにFirefoxでアクセスします。 「Clone or download」をクリックして、「Download ZIP」をクリックして、このリポ…

Tensorflowをインストールする

さて、ようやく本題に近づいてきました。 今回は、Tensorflowをインストールしてみます。 Tensorflowの公式サイトでは、「オープンソース機械学習プラットフォーム」と説明されています。できることは色々あるようですが、ディープラーニング(AIの一種)の…

Tensorflowをインストールする(失敗)

さて、ようやく本題に近づいてきました。 今回は、Tensorflowをインストールしてみます。 Tensorflowの公式サイトでは、「オープンソース機械学習プラットフォーム」と説明されています。できることは色々あるようですが、ディープラーニング(AIの一種)の…